Co to jest łaska boża
hodyreva [135]

Łaska, która pochodzi z greckiego Nowego Testamentu słowo Charis, jest Niezasłużona łaską Boga. To jest życzliwość od Boga, że nie zasługują. Nie ma nic, co zrobiliśmy, ani nigdy nie może zrobić, aby zarobić na tę korzyść. Jest darem od Boga.
